    })(CompletionItemKind || (exports.CompletionItemKind = CompletionItemKind = {}));
    /**
     * Defines whether the insert text in a completion item should be interpreted as
     * plain text or a snippet.
     */
    var InsertTextFormat;
    (function (InsertTextFormat) {
        /**
         * The primary text to be inserted is treated as a plain string.
         */
        InsertTextFormat.PlainText = 1;
        /**
         * The primary text to be inserted is treated as a snippet.
         *
         * A snippet can define tab stops and placeholders with `$1`, `$2`
         * and `${3:foo}`. `$0` defines the final tab stop, it defaults to
         * the end of the snippet. Placeholders with equal identifiers are linked,
         * that is typing in one will update others too.
         *
         * See also: https://microsoft.github.io/language-server-protocol/specifications/specification-current/#snippet_syntax
         */
        InsertTextFormat.Snippet = 2;
    })(InsertTextFormat || (exports.InsertTextFormat = InsertTextFormat = {}));
    /**
     * Completion item tags are extra annotations that tweak the rendering of a completion
     * item.
     *
     * @since 3.15.0
     */
    var CompletionItemTag;
    (function (CompletionItemTag) {
        /**
         * Render a completion as obsolete, usually using a strike-out.
         */
        CompletionItemTag.Deprecated = 1;
    })(CompletionItemTag || (exports.CompletionItemTag = CompletionItemTag = {}));
    /**
     * The InsertReplaceEdit namespace provides functions to deal with insert / replace edits.
     *
     * @since 3.16.0
     */
    var InsertReplaceEdit;
    (function (InsertReplaceEdit) {
        /**
         * Creates a new insert / replace edit
         */
        function create(newText, insert, replace) {
            return { newText: newText, insert: insert, replace: replace };
        }
        InsertReplaceEdit.create = create;
        /**
         * Checks whether the given literal conforms to the {@link InsertReplaceEdit} interface.
         */
        function is(value) {
            var candidate = value;
            return candidate && Is.string(candidate.newText) && Range.is(candidate.insert) && Range.is(candidate.replace);
        }
        InsertReplaceEdit.is = is;
    })(InsertReplaceEdit || (exports.InsertReplaceEdit = InsertReplaceEdit = {}));
    /**
     * How whitespace and indentation is handled during completion
     * item insertion.
     *
     * @since 3.16.0
     */
    var InsertTextMode;
    (function (InsertTextMode) {
        /**
         * The insertion or replace strings is taken as it is. If the
         * value is multi line the lines below the cursor will be
         * inserted using the indentation defined in the string value.
         * The client will not apply any kind of adjustments to the
         * string.
         */
        InsertTextMode.asIs = 1;
        /**
         * The editor adjusts leading whitespace of new lines so that
         * they match the indentation up to the cursor of the line for
         * which the item is accepted.
         *
         * Consider a line like this: <2tabs><cursor><3tabs>foo. Accepting a
         * multi line completion item is indented using 2 tabs and all
         * following lines inserted will be indented using 2 tabs as well.
         */
        InsertTextMode.adjustIndentation = 2;
    })(InsertTextMode || (exports.InsertTextMode = InsertTextMode = {}));
    /**
     * Defines how values from a set of defaults and an individual item will be
     * merged.
     *
     * @since 3.18.0
     */
    var ApplyKind;
    (function (ApplyKind) {
        /**
         * The value from the individual item (if provided and not `null`) will be
         * used instead of the default.
         */
        ApplyKind.Replace = 1;
        /**
         * The value from the item will be merged with the default.
         *
         * The specific rules for mergeing values are defined against each field
         * that supports merging.
         */
        ApplyKind.Merge = 2;
    })(ApplyKind || (exports.ApplyKind = ApplyKind = {}));

    /**
     * A set of predefined code action kinds
     */
    var CodeActionKind;
    (function (CodeActionKind) {
        /**
         * Empty kind.
         */
        CodeActionKind.Empty = '';
        /**
         * Base kind for quickfix actions: 'quickfix'
         */
        CodeActionKind.QuickFix = 'quickfix';
        /**
         * Base kind for refactoring actions: 'refactor'
         */
        CodeActionKind.Refactor = 'refactor';
        /**
         * Base kind for refactoring extraction actions: 'refactor.extract'
         *
         * Example extract actions:
         *
         * - Extract method
         * - Extract function
         * - Extract variable
         * - Extract interface from class
         * - ...
         */
        CodeActionKind.RefactorExtract = 'refactor.extract';
        /**
         * Base kind for refactoring inline actions: 'refactor.inline'
         *
         * Example inline actions:
         *
         * - Inline function
         * - Inline variable
         * - Inline constant
         * - ...
         */
        CodeActionKind.RefactorInline = 'refactor.inline';
        /**
         * Base kind for refactoring move actions: `refactor.move`
         *
         * Example move actions:
         *
         * - Move a function to a new file
         * - Move a property between classes
         * - Move method to base class
         * - ...
         *
         * @since 3.18.0
         */
        CodeActionKind.RefactorMove = 'refactor.move';
        /**
         * Base kind for refactoring rewrite actions: 'refactor.rewrite'
         *
         * Example rewrite actions:
         *
         * - Convert JavaScript function to class
         * - Add or remove parameter
         * - Encapsulate field
         * - Make method static
         * - Move method to base class
         * - ...
         */
        CodeActionKind.RefactorRewrite = 'refactor.rewrite';
        /**
         * Base kind for source actions: `source`
         *
         * Source code actions apply to the entire file.
         */
        CodeActionKind.Source = 'source';
        /**
         * Base kind for an organize imports source action: `source.organizeImports`
         */
        CodeActionKind.SourceOrganizeImports = 'source.organizeImports';
        /**
         * Base kind for auto-fix source actions: `source.fixAll`.
         *
         * Fix all actions automatically fix errors that have a clear fix that do not require user input.
         * They should not suppress errors or perform unsafe fixes such as generating new types or classes.
         *
         * @since 3.15.0
         */
        CodeActionKind.SourceFixAll = 'source.fixAll';
        /**
         * Base kind for all code actions applying to the entire notebook's scope. CodeActionKinds using
         * this should always begin with `notebook.`
         *
         * @since 3.18.0
         */
        CodeActionKind.Notebook = 'notebook';
    })(CodeActionKind || (exports.CodeActionKind = CodeActionKind = {}));
    /**
     * The reason why code actions were requested.
     *
     * @since 3.17.0
     */
    var CodeActionTriggerKind;
    (function (CodeActionTriggerKind) {
        /**
         * Code actions were explicitly requested by the user or by an extension.
         */
        CodeActionTriggerKind.Invoked = 1;
        /**
         * Code actions were requested automatically.
         *
         * This typically happens when current selection in a file changes, but can
         * also be triggered when file content changes.
         */
        CodeActionTriggerKind.Automatic = 2;
    })(CodeActionTriggerKind || (exports.CodeActionTriggerKind = CodeActionTriggerKind = {}));

    /**
     * @deprecated Use the text document from the new vscode-languageserver-textdocument package.
     */
    var TextDocument;
    (function (TextDocument) {
        /**
         * Creates a new ITextDocument literal from the given uri and content.
         * @param uri The document's uri.
         * @param languageId The document's language Id.
         * @param version The document's version.
         * @param content The document's content.
         */
        function create(uri, languageId, version, content) {
            return new FullTextDocument(uri, languageId, version, content);
        }
        TextDocument.create = create;
        /**
         * Checks whether the given literal conforms to the {@link ITextDocument} interface.
         */
        function is(value) {
            var candidate = value;
            return Is.defined(candidate) && Is.string(candidate.uri) && (Is.undefined(candidate.languageId) || Is.string(candidate.languageId)) && Is.uinteger(candidate.lineCount)
                && Is.func(candidate.getText) && Is.func(candidate.positionAt) && Is.func(candidate.offsetAt) ? true : false;
        }
        TextDocument.is = is;
        function applyEdits(document, edits) {
            var text = document.getText();
            var sortedEdits = mergeSort(edits, function (a, b) {
                var diff = a.range.start.line - b.range.start.line;
                if (diff === 0) {
                    return a.range.start.character - b.range.start.character;
                }
                return diff;
            });
            var lastModifiedOffset = text.length;
            for (var i = sortedEdits.length -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
                var e = sortedEdits[i];
                var startOffset = document.offsetAt(e.range.start);
                var endOffset = document.offsetAt(e.range.end);
                if (endOffset <= lastModifiedOffset) {
                    text = text.substring(0, startOffset) + e.newText + text.substring(endOffset, text.length);
                }
                else {
                    throw new Error('Overlapping edit');
                }
                lastModifiedOffset = startOffset;
            }
            return text;
        }
        TextDocument.applyEdits = applyEdits;
        function mergeSort(data, compare) {
            if (data.length <= 1) {
                // sorted
                return data;
            }
            var p = (data.length / 2) | 0;
            var left = data.slice(0, p);
            var right = data.slice(p);
            mergeSort(left, compare);
            mergeSort(right, compare);
            var leftIdx = 0;
            var rightIdx = 0;
            var i = 0;
            while (leftIdx < left.length && rightIdx < right.length) {
                var ret = compare(left[leftIdx], right[rightIdx]);
                if (ret <= 0) {
                    // smaller_equal -> take left to preserve order
                    data[i++] = left[leftIdx++];
                }
                else {
                    // greater -> take right
                    data[i++] = right[rightIdx++];
                }
            }
            while (leftIdx < left.length) {
                data[i++] = left[leftIdx++];
            }
            while (rightIdx < right.length) {
                data[i++] = right[rightIdx++];
            }
            return data;
        }
    })(TextDocument || (exports.TextDocument = TextDocument = {}));
    /**
     * @deprecated Use the text document from the new vscode-languageserver-textdocument package.
     */
    var FullTextDocument = /** @class */ (function () {
        function FullTextDocument(uri, languageId, version, content) {
            this._uri = uri;
            this._languageId = languageId;
            this._version = version;
            this._content = content;
            this._lineOffsets = undefined;
        }
        Object.defineProperty(FullTextDocument.prototype, "uri", {
            get: function () {
                return this._uri;
            },
            enumerable: false,
            configurable: true
        });
        Object.defineProperty(FullTextDocument.prototype, "languageId", {
            get: function () {
                return this._languageId;
            },
            enumerable: false,
            configurable: true
        });
        Object.defineProperty(FullTextDocument.prototype, "version", {
            get: function () {
                return this._version;
            },
            enumerable: false,
            configurable: true
        });
        FullTextDocument.prototype.getText = function (range) {
            if (range) {
                var start = this.offsetAt(range.start);
                var end = this.offsetAt(range.end);
                return this._content.substring(start, end);
            }
            return this._content;
        };
        FullTextDocument.prototype.update = function (event, version) {
            this._content = event.text;
            this._version = version;
            this._lineOffsets = undefined;
        };
        FullTextDocument.prototype.getLineOffsets = function () {
            if (this._lineOffsets === undefined) {
                var lineOffsets = [];
                var text = this._content;
                var isLineStart = true;
                for (var i = 0; i < text.length; i++) {
                    if (isLineStart) {
                        lineOffsets.push(i);
                        isLineStart = false;
                    }
                    var ch = text.charAt(i);
                    isLineStart = (ch === '\r' || ch === '\n');
                    if (ch === '\r' && i + 1 < text.length && text.charAt(i + 1) === '\n') {
                        i++;
                    }
                }
                if (isLineStart && text.length > 0) {
                    lineOffsets.push(text.length);
                }
                this._lineOffsets = lineOffsets;
            }
            return this._lineOffsets;
        };
        FullTextDocument.prototype.positionAt = function (offset) {
            offset = Math.max(Math.min(offset, this._content.length), 0);
            var lineOffsets = this.getLineOffsets();
            var low = 0, high = lineOffsets.length;
            if (high === 0) {
                return Position.create(0, offset);
            }
            while (low < high) {
                var mid = Math.floor((low + high) / 2);
                if (lineOffsets[mid] > offset) {
                    high = mid;
                }
                else {
                    low = mid + 1;
                }
            }
            // low is the least x for which the line offset is larger than the current offset
            // or array.length if no line offset is larger than the current offset
            var line = low - 1;
            return Position.create(line, offset - lineOffsets[line]);
        };
        FullTextDocument.prototype.offsetAt = function (position) {
            var lineOffsets = this.getLineOffsets();
            if (position.line >= lineOffsets.length) {
                return this._content.length;
            }
            else if (position.line < 0) {
                return 0;
            }
            var lineOffset = lineOffsets[position.line];
            var nextLineOffset = (position.line + 1 < lineOffsets.length) ? lineOffsets[position.line + 1] : this._content.length;
            return Math.max(Math.min(lineOffset + position.character, nextLineOffset), lineOffset);
        };
        Object.defineProperty(FullTextDocument.prototype, "lineCount", {
            get: function () {
                return this.getLineOffsets().length;
            },
            enumerable: false,
            configurable: true
        });
        return FullTextDocument;
    }());
